Output 66fb1fd0a8293b0bc005725643816dd78318680143d08f8161ed444c4eee57ee:0

value
15946
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6fad60bb541a3ea1a20d7cc9659323f85036a701ca6161ad266cee7a23bf0963
address
bc1pd7kkpw65rgl2rgsd0nyktyerlpgrdfcpefskrtfxdnh85galp93sruzqmk
transaction
66fb1fd0a8293b0bc005725643816dd78318680143d08f8161ed444c4eee57ee
spent
true